The Aramid Honeycomb Core Materials Market is witnessing sustained growth as industries increasingly adopt advanced lightweight materials that deliver superior mechanical performance, structural stability, and long-term durability. Aramid honeycomb core materials are engineered with a unique cellular structure that provides exceptional strength while minimizing overall weight, making them an ideal choice for applications where efficiency and reliability are essential. Their excellent fire resistance, impact absorption, fatigue performance, and corrosion resistance have made them widely accepted across aerospace, defense, rail transportation, marine engineering, industrial equipment, and renewable energy sectors. The aerospace sector remains one of the largest application areas for aramid honeycomb core materials. Aircraft manufacturers continuously seek innovative solutions that improve fuel efficiency, reduce structural mass, and enhance passenger safety. Honeycomb composite panels are widely utilized in aircraft flooring, cabin walls, overhead compartments, cargo liners, doors, ceilings, and interior structural assemblies. Their lightweight characteristics contribute to improved operational efficiency while maintaining the strength required for demanding aviation environments.

Defense modernization programs are also increasing demand for advanced composite materials. Military aircraft, naval vessels, armored vehicles, surveillance systems, and tactical equipment require lightweight structures capable of performing reliably under extreme operating conditions. Aramid honeycomb cores provide excellent impact resistance, dimensional stability, and thermal performance, making them highly suitable for defense applications requiring long-term structural reliability.

The automotive industry is increasingly exploring composite materials to support next-generation mobility solutions. Vehicle manufacturers continue focusing on lightweight construction to improve energy efficiency, driving performance, and overall vehicle design. Aramid honeycomb structures are being evaluated for battery enclosures, vehicle flooring, body panels, crash protection systems, and interior structural components where reduced weight contributes to improved operational efficiency.

Rail transportation systems are also benefiting from advanced honeycomb technologies. Passenger trains require lightweight interior structures that enhance operational efficiency while maintaining passenger comfort and safety. Honeycomb composite materials are commonly incorporated into flooring systems, wall partitions, ceiling panels, luggage compartments, and seating structures because they provide excellent stiffness and long service life with minimal additional weight.

Marine manufacturers increasingly rely on lightweight composite materials to improve vessel performance. Honeycomb core panels are used in hull structures, decks, cabin interiors, bulkheads, and marine flooring where corrosion resistance and weight reduction are essential. Lighter vessels can improve operational efficiency while supporting better fuel economy and easier maneuverability across commercial and recreational marine applications.

Industrial engineering applications continue expanding as manufacturers seek durable materials capable of performing in challenging environments. Aramid honeycomb structures are used in machinery enclosures, automation systems, clean-room facilities, specialized equipment platforms, and industrial infrastructure where mechanical strength and dimensional stability are required.
